Luke,

Getting back to the original question, when someone comes to you that has been fitted to a "conventional" address postion, and now is a Hitter, using Impact Fix, and certainly has the Right Forearm on the Shaft Plane, do you typically see a change required for the Lie Angle of the club?

My first impression was that when getting the Right Forearm on Plane, it would require a little Flatter Lie Angle. Do you see any typcal patterns in club modifications when guys go from a "conventionally taught" address (arms hanging) to Impact Fix in your experience?
